What are the flea remedies for cats? - in detail
Fleas are a common issue for cats, and addressing them promptly is essential to ensure the health and comfort of your pet. The first step in treating fleas is identifying their presence, which can be done by observing excessive scratching, redness, or small black specks (flea dirt) in the fur. Once confirmed, there are several effective remedies available. Topical treatments, such as spot-on solutions, are widely used and applied directly to the skin, typically between the shoulder blades. These treatments contain active ingredients like fipronil, imidacloprid, or selamectin, which kill fleas and often prevent reinfestation for several weeks. Oral medications are another option, with products containing nitenpyram or spinosad providing rapid relief by killing fleas within hours. Flea collars are a long-term preventive measure, releasing chemicals that repel and kill fleas over several months. Shampoos and sprays can be used for immediate relief, though they are generally less effective for long-term control. Environmental management is equally important, as fleas can reside in carpets, bedding, and furniture. Regular vacuuming, washing pet bedding in hot water, and using household flea sprays or foggers can help eliminate fleas from the environment. Additionally, treating all pets in the household simultaneously is crucial to prevent cross-infestation. For severe infestations or persistent issues, consulting a veterinarian is recommended to determine the most appropriate treatment plan. Preventative measures, such as regular use of flea control products, are essential to keep your cat flea-free and healthy. Always follow the instructions on products carefully and monitor your cat for any adverse reactions.
